People often lament about being the ones left behind, however I can state with near absolute certainty that I will never be one of them. If the tale relayed to me by friend Onan is to be believed, I am thankful that I was left with crewman Goldt to guard the hatch from Frame 13 to Frame 14.
Apparently, after moving into the parts of the ship contaminated by the Warp, my companions moved aft through the less traveled spaces. While they realized that this would take longer, I believe that they felt that safety was more important than speed in this endeavour. Luckily, they happened upon a Damage Control Panel, which Crewman Jamez was able to bring online. This panel illustrated that the issue experienced by the bridge was caused by a shearing in the control runs between the bridge and main engineering. Unfortunately, to repair this fault, the crewmen needed to obtain repair materials from the Machine Shop and bring them to an exposed section of the ship's Main Corridor, just above the keel control run.
Fighting their way bravely into the Machine Shop, my companions killed a number of mutated crewmen, driven mad by bloodlust and a horrifyingly insatiable appetite for flesh... by which I mean the mutants, obviously, not my companions. Onan used a fair number of bullets in the battle, and Cromwell was judicious in his use of his lasgun, while Paziel... well, he is frightening with that blade of his! Anyway, the crew took a few losses, but were ultimately able to fabricate the parts that they needed. Under Cromwell's direction, they activated the fabbers in the machine shop in order to draw the mutants away from the area of decking they needed to work on, then set about repairing the control runs. Once main power and control was restored to the aft sections of the ship, the Captain activated Servitors throughout the ship, and they began mercilessly butchering the mutants. It is likely to take some time to properly clean the areas aft of Frame 13, and I am reluctant to return to our cabin because of it.
It was at this point that we learned that our abrupt transition to real space left us without any way to determine a course back to civilization! The Captain had determined that we would be best served allowing our Navigators and Astropaths work together to determine a course, however that could take weeks, and we would likely run out of food well before they were able to do so. The Purser, a dour fellow named Salvio Brontus, however recommended that we instead examine the derelict starship nearby and see if some charts could be salvaged from it.
Onan, Cromwell, and Paziel alternately charmed and bullied the captain into allowing the Purser to take a team over and see if perhaps they could find some charts, or perhaps even resupply of food. The ship, an ancient Commonwealth Battleship, obviously crippled during the Empire's glorious Crusade to free the Lupus Cluster from the misguided rulers who had led them from the Emperor's true light, was obviously well beyond any reasonable idea of salvage, but perhaps there might have been some items hidden away in its twisted structure. We could be hope and pray to the Emperor.
Thankfully, I was left behind on the shuttle as my companions took a pair of Tech Priests inside along with the scavenging party. That was the last I heard from them, and I do hope that they are alright...

I will be posting a write-up of last session tomorrow, however here is some Lupus Cluster information:
Stellar Cartography & Expanded History
Located in the area where the Halo Stars region abuts the Ghoul Stars to the Galactic North and anti-spinward of Dimmamar, the Lupus Cluster is a dense stellar cluster filled mainly with older F, G, and K-type main sequence stars. Shannedam County contains roughly 30 inhabitable planets (though some stretch that definition) and 25 stars with no habitable worlds. In addition, there are hundreds of small Asteroidal and deep space colonies including a half dozen massive space hulks and the supremely complex super-station Etna.
It's location in one of the most desolate backwaters of the Empire of Man meant that secession and security during the Horus Heresy (circa AD 30,000) were easily obtained. As it was a fairly insignificant area, the Lupus Cluster was ignored by both the Empire and the forces of Chaos, and the entire Cluster was lost in bureaucratic filings in the centuries after the rebellion and the mortal wounding of the Emperor.
2,000 years ago information on the region was rediscovered, and exploration ships were sent to determine what had happened to the long silent Lupus Cluster. At the end of their long journey, the Empire of Man's scouts were shocked by what they discovered. What they found was a pocket empire ruled by the descendants of Emil Brax, and Imperial Army Grand Marshal. World after world in an inter-stellar community, working for a strong central government and keeping to themselves for fear of drawing the attention of the forces of Chaos or the forces of the Empire.
In AD 37,451 The Empire of man dispatched a full Ordo Hereticus team with support of the Black Templars, the Adepta Sororitas (Sisters of Battle), the 13th Vostroyan, the 421st Cadian, the 555th Valhallan, and 121st Mordian Guards under the combined leadership of Inquisitor Aldus Denarius, Brother General Espirito, Grand Admiral Mastricht and Grand General Anselm Keserdal. Although the Lupus Cluster had robust defenses and a rather large army, the Crusaders under the guide of the Holy Inquisition had numbers, experience, and the Emperor on their side. The war for the Cluster lasted barely 115 years and was considered among the most successful pacifications in the Inquisition's history. Victory was presided upon by the leadership of the newly elevated Grand General Gyorg Shannedam, who took over for Keserdal in the last years of the pacification campaign.
The people of the Lupus Cluster grudgingly took their place amongst the citizens of the Empire, and though they were held in check by force of arms, they cooperated with the invaders and the occupation forces. As the Empire exerted its influence with priests of the Adeptus Terra and the Cult of the Machine God taking over the education of the masses, people began to become accustomed to their new roles.
After ruling the Cluster as Sector Governor for nearly 60 years, Gyorg Shannedam died at the hands of an assassin. The people were told that the Grand General died of old age in service to his Empire, but rumors persisted. Most top aides were told that the murder was at the hands of an anti-Empire group, but the truth was that the assassination came at the orders of Inquisitor Bartholomew Addis. Inquisitor Addis saw that Shannedam was lightening the iron grip of the Empire in order to foster better relations to the subject worlds. This had made him popular, but also meant that he was dangerously close to falling into apostasy by allowing these former rebels too many freedoms too soon. It was also rumored that the Grand General had adopted too many of the manners and ideas of the original Lupus Cluster government, influenced no doubt by councilors and advisors from the rebel faction. A governmental purge was quietly carried out while the people mourned their well-respected Governor.
Several years after the death of Gyorg Shannedam, the people of the Cluster decided to rename the capital county in his honor, thus creating Shannedam County (as well as four surrounding counties which were named Keserdal, Denarius, Mastricht, and Espirito). Over the centuries, the old ways slowly succumbed to the ways of the Empire, and the cult of the God Emperor took root firmly. The discovery of large deposits of valuable minerals and ores eventually lead to Rogue Trader families striking out for the Lupus Cluster in the hope of riches and reward.
Now, in the 41st millennium, the Lupus Cluster is a populous, and prosperous area. Under the tutelage of the Priesthood and the Inquisition, most of the worlds have embraced the Empire's ideals. While most planets are Imperial or Hive worlds, there are still a few Feral planets out there, beholden only to the occasional tithe ship that lands to take on psykers and supplies. Most planets are ruled by a Baron who takes the role of Imperial Governor, and a few of the local corporations have the same structure. This means that Industrial Barons often vie against Planetary Barons for influence with the Sector Governor.

What started as the office of the Sector Governor two thousand years before turned eventually into the Ministorum office of the Lord Sector roughly 500 years after the death of Gyrog Shannedam. Unlike many Adeptus Terra offices, the role of Lord Sector of the Lupus Cluster has been a hereditary one for nearly 1,500 years. Passed from father to son, and sometimes from familia to familia within the Great Houses of the Sector, the office has been dominated almost exclusively by the rather devout Sanguarelli family for the past few decades. The current Lord Sector is Ferdinand Sanguarelli, a bluff, square jawed man of little humor and few words. He rules Shannedam County and the Lupus Cluster with a bit more of a forcefully iron fisted policy than is normal for this relatively quiet backwater. It is rumored that the familia Sanguarelli is may be looking to replace him with his younger brother Antonius, who is far more level headed.
House Alda
House Alda maintains complete control of the planet Mysia, reaping huge profits from both Prometheum mining and Gennium-Arsenic crystal mining as well as the operation of multiple factories for the Munitorium of the Empire. House Alda has full backing of the local Tech Priests of the nearby planet Iol which have allowed this influential House access to the Iol-Pattern Lasgun, as well as a number of tanks and equipment. Baron Aldus Alda is said to possess a large militia, equivalent to five full Imperial Guard heavy tank regiments. Though they claim that this is because they now control seven worlds in Shannedam County (Mysia, Caralis, Grosianus, Hamper, Yin, Ancona, Olisipio, Fager, and Ve'Fros), most see this as House Alda's bid for future control of the office of the Lord Sector, and those their troop movements are generally viewed with a great deal of suspicion by their neighbors in House Thoreson and the ruling family of House Sanguarelli.
House Kishihiro
Novuta Industries is controlled by Donatella Kishihiro, sometimes referred to as the Iron Sow. Like House Alda, Novuta Industries and the Kishihiro family control vast manufacturing and industrial bases, as well as a number of mineral worlds. House Kishihiro relies on subtlety and guile in its business dealings, though, and generally supplies hand-to-hand combat weapons and pistols to the military as well as being the largest producers of VOX casters, computational devices, medicae packs, and other support devices. Baroness Kishihiro was actually born to the Sanguarelli family and married Notaku Kishihiro and eventually wound up in charge of the family (after divorcing herself from the Sanguarellis). At present, Kishihiro controls Novuta, Crow Call, Inkit Lamp, Impulse, Rolunitru, and Tontrinas, though it is likely that the marriage of Yoshi Kishihiro to Baroness M'tubo will bring Deiop under Kishihiro control soon.
House Marioc-Tremnar[/u]
One of the most prominent and influential Houses in the Sector, House Marioc, which originated on Alactra in the Calixis Sector controls major stakes in a number of industries and families. Intermarried with the Tremnars who control the world of Yois, as well as the Singhs, the Mariocs control the vital corridor from Sparta, where they have complete control of Ingham Mining and Materiel, to Ciria, through Yois and Olisipio and over to Iol. Since the days of the Crusade, and the exploits of the Marioc's Pride and the Lady Malbec, House Marioc has oft been an example of diligence to the throne, though their cousins the Tremnars have almost as equally been the center of scandal. Houses Marioc and Tremnar are in an almost constant state of war with House Wulfe.
House Sanguarelli[/u]
The house that rules the roost in Shannedam County did not obtain that honor without sacrifice or cause. Though they maintain Tarraco as one of their holdings mainly due to the location of the Capital there, House Sanguarelli is spread out throughout the northernmost reaches of the County, controlling the important Forge Worlds of Rilus V, Ope'Diar, and Tiven as well as the mining worlds of New Janos, Moshelle, and, most recently, Turbanos. None of these match in importance to their possession of the holy Cardinal World of Ku Crassus, over which they have a role as protectors owing to their families close ties to the Adeptus Terra,the Ministorum, and the Cult of Saint Herastis the Pure. The House is ruled by Rosario Sanguarelli, and Cardinal Giovanni 'Batista' Sanguarelli controls all access to Ku Crassus with the aide of a batallion of Adepta Sororitas under the command of Abbess Ilista Pentaria. There is currently a debate within the family about the wisdom of maintaining Ferdinand in the position of Lord Sector, or transferring Antonius from Tiven to Tarraco to take control of the County.
House Singh
Controlling the three most vital food producing worlds in the sector, Henders, Wuj, and Defiance, as well as a number of minor world that produce exotic lumbers and textiles, House Singh is affluent but lacks the clout that the more industrialized houses have.
House Thoreson
Unlike the majority of the other houses, House Thoreson only really controls one inhabitable planet: Thaspus. As Baron of Thaspus, Reginald Thoreson controls one of the most beautiful and peaceful worlds in the Sector, but the star system that Thaspus inhabits is possibly the most crucial to Shannedam as it is the gateway into the heart of the Ultima Segmentum. It is the Orbital Works at Phorisin as well as the Shipyards at Iphigion, the Deep Space Manufactorum at Cleon, the massive Dry Docks and Repair Yards at Philus and Parus, and the Hephaeston Station at Palandar that have made Thoreson the most wealthy House in the County. Wheeling and dealing with major players from all five counties, and suppling weapons, systems, and components to almost every manufactorum in the Sector, House Thoreson is a force to be reckoned with. To showcase his disdain of House Alda, Reginald is currently courting Hypatia Arandopolous, Baroness of Messana in the dual hopes of gaining his old House some new blood as well as a new, resource rich, world that House Alda wants. Reginald's brother Bryan is married to Baroness Chun of Pisae, and his sister is married to Baron Gyles de Roche of Saguntum. Neither marriage has benefitted the House in any great way.
House Wulfe
The distaff branch of the larger House Wolfe in the Calixis Sector, House Wulfe rose to prominence during the early years of the Lupus Cluster Crusade. While there have been many implications of semi-heretical practices over the centuries, the Wulfes have always weathered the storm. Still, their fortunes have fallen considerably since their heyday, likely due to their ongoing feud with both House Marioc and House Tremnar, as well as IMM. Currently House Wulfe controls a half-dozens minor systems, none of which provide much in the way of profit for the House. While there has been no large-scale examination of the Wulfe bloodline, many suspect that there has been some form of genetic manipulation or mutation as the females of the House frequently give birth to triplets, quadruplets, quintuplets or larger 'litters'.

The Imperial Corporate Charters
Unlike many other sectors in the Empire, the Lupus Cluster has a requirement for Imperial Charters for all corporations introduced in this region of space. Ostensibly, the original reason was to prevent the local corporations from continuing to promulgate heretical, anti-Empire concepts, but the truth was that the discovery of a number of vital mineral deposits on many of the worlds in this reason made the Lord Solar and the High Lords of the Empire nervous about the leanings of corporate heads. In the early days of the Sector Government, Corporations were saddled with an Imperial Auditor who sat as COO of the corporation to ensure that all operations were conducted in strict accordance with Imperial doctrine, law, and dogma. The position of Auditor evolved into the Lupus Corps of Officiators, also called the Officario or Officariat. Every Corporation that has a charter must have an Officario on their Board of Directors.
There are a number of major Corporations in Shannedam County.
Border Worlds Exports
Better known as Bowex, Border Worlds Exports does a brisk factoring business with Rogue Trader Families who do not wish to develop trade routes in the Lupus Cluster itself. Though nowhere near as powerful as Hephaeston Station Corporation, Bowex still has a bit of clout. It is rumored that Bowex is looking to force Fager, the world that houses their Corporate headquarters, to secede from House Alda's control. If their plans are successful, then they will be better able to deal with the other noble houses in the Sector without Alda's interference. Of course, making an enemy of House Alda is not without its own problems.
Dolittle Industries
The planet Dolittle is the home of Dolittle Industries, the largest producer of pre-fabricated buildings in the Sector. Their motto, Do a Lot with Dolittle, can be found on structures throughout the Sector, and in many military structures out on the Frontier. It is rumored that Dolittle Industries is looking to establish itself as a greater power in Sector politics as Baron John Dolittle is currently attempting to woo Francesca Sanguarelli to get himself into that prestigious family. As an alliance with the Dolittles will not really aid in the ambitions of the Sanguarellis, it is unlikely that Baron Dolittle will get far in his courting.
Ingham Mining and Metals
Based in orbit of the Feral death world of Sparta Hill, Ingham Mining and Metals is slowly tearing the Lum system apart for its massive mineral wealth. Widely regarded as one of the greediest Chartered Corporations in the Sector, Ingham has long held that its services are so vital to Imperial Munitorium Production that it justifies its behavior. The massive refineries and smelters of IMM have poured so much detritus into the system that specially built Adeptus Mechanicus Cruisers have to clear paths through what have been dubbed the Sparta Smog Clouds. Each cloud is mapped and charted, with the Adeptus Cruisers maintaining navigation lanes through them. The system is routinely patrolled by members of House Marioc, which controls the entire system and owns a 90% stake in IMM, which was named after Ingham Wachs, a Seneschal on the Marioc's Endeavour who began the process of building the refineries and smelters in the system instead of bringing them to Hubble or Ciria for processing, cutting months off the transport time.
Kal-Tyr-Alco
During the great Interregnum, when the Lupus Cluster was cut off from the rest of the Empire by Emil Brax, a decision was made to abandon the Botanical Research colonies that had been founded on Kalapana, Tyra, and Alcove V. The inhabitants of these retained enough science and technology to remain in contact with each other, and it is widely rumored that the Empire's Crusade to re-take the Lupus Cluster was spurred on by contact with these worlds. The fact remains that when the Wolf Worlds were re-integrated into the Empire, these three Feral Worlds formed a combined Corporation and were given an immediate Charter. The descendants of the original scientists on all three worlds had discovered a number of miraculous herbal remedies and medicinal compounds on their inhospitable worlds, and thus Kal-Tyr-Alco is the largest pharmaceutical company in the Sector, and its exports can be found across the Empire.
Mannpower, Inc.
The time-honored tradition of slavery is still alive and well in the Lupus Cluster, though it takes a different guise in the form of Manpower, Inc. Manpower started its life as a simple work placement Corporation, shuttling workers from world to world to fill vacancies left by death or retirement with the best possible applicants. When they acquired the Outer Nebraska Penalty Corporation in late 39,355, Manpower found a new calling: using prisoners as cheap slave labor. Eventually, Manpower gave up its original business of job placement and invested all of its resources into its new Prison Placement Program. The 3P, as it is known, offers planetary governments a cheap alternative to maintaining their own prisons. Manpower will process the prisoners and make them available as needed for parole or trails for a small fee. Manpower then turns each prisoner over to one of its five prison planets (Outer Nebraska, Kroft, Violin III, Betz, and Jacob's Star) and forces them into a life of forced labor. Few prisoners ever emerge from the 3P without some kind of scars.
Planetform, Inc
Planetform is the greatest story of success and failure in the entire Sector. Millennia ago, Planetform was founded in an attempt to terraform several of the less pleasant planets in the Lupus Cluster. Starting with Saguntum III, Trader's Paradise, Caesar's Folly, and Gustaviv's Regret, the Company began long term experiments into turning these planets into paradises. While they achieved complete success on Trader's Paradise and Caesar's Folly, Gustaviv's Regret and Saguntum III are both complete disasters. It has taken centuries for Planetform to reach any stage of completion on either of its spectacular failures, and the fact that both have been unceremoniously turned into Hive Worlds does not bode well for future projects.
Xenophon-Yarulowski-Zapata Combine
Better known as either XYZ or the Combine, this is the largest of all of the Chartered Corporations Shannedam County (and probably the Sector). There is no industry that is not touched on by one of XYZ's innumerable divisions and operations. From their Company HQ on Mala, the Combine oversees operations on pretty much every single planet in the County, with the exceptions of Thaspus, Zama, and Mavinav. XYZ started its life as a chain of cheap eateries on Mala during the Interregnum, but their popularity spread like wild fire, and soon there were Zapatas Bistros throughout the Lupus Cluster. Their clout on Mala became so pronounced that they gained almost total control of the planet's elected government. Eventually they branched out into communications with the acquisition of Xenophon Broadcasting on Laua, and finally they burst into manufacturing with Yarowalski Assemblers on Newport. When the Crusade came, the Empire found this massive mega-corporation sitting like a giant puppeteer with strings leading to every planet in the sector. In exchange for the bloodless surrenders of Mala, Newport, Laua, Tayz, Anders, Cyclic, and Hubble, the Combine was granted an Amnesty by Inquisitor Denarius. Unfortunately, their appointed Auditor executed many of the principal members of the Combine, and XYZ spent the next few centuries rebuilding from the devastation. Now XYZ is as powerful as ever, and their reach extends into all levels of civilian life. It is almost impossible to purchase any product that has not been handled by XYZ at some stage in its life.
